Defining Discount Toilets
So, what exactly does it mean when we talk about discount toilets? In essence, discount toilets are those items priced lower than the market average due to various reasons. Unlike regular models found in upscale showrooms, these toilets can be sourced from warehouse clubs, clearance sections, or even online outlets. Generally, they might not carry the same high-end brand names but can still perform effectively and contribute positively to your bathroom’s ambiance.
It’s important to recognize that the term "discount" does not equate to inferior quality. Many manufacturers offer perfectly functional products at reduced prices to clear out inventory, introduce new lines, or even cater to budget-sensitive consumers.
Reasons for Discount Pricing
There are several reasons why you might find toilets labeled as "discount." Here are a few common ones:
- Excess Inventory: Sometimes retailers stockpile more toilets than what’s necessary. To make room for newer models, they cut prices on existing stock.
- Model Changes: When manufacturers design newer models, the older ones often see significant price drops to entice buyers.
- Minor Cosmetic Flaws: Occasionally, discount toilets may have slight scratches or dents that don’t affect functionality but are enough for sellers to provide a price reduction.
- Seasonal Sales: Events such as Black Friday or end-of-season clearances can present golden opportunities to grab toilets at significantly discounted rates.

Single-piece Toilets
Single-piece toilets are a seamless blend of toilet and tank, designed to form a sleek, one-unit structure. This design minimizes the crevices typically found in a traditional two-piece setup, making it easier to clean and maintain. The smooth lines lend an air of modernity to the bathroom while offering added convenience.
When opting for a single-piece toilet, you’ll often find that these models have a compact form, which is ideal for smaller spaces. Additionally, they are usually more affordable due to their simpler construction. The ease of installation is another plus, as most models come with everything needed for a straightforward setup.
"Single-piece toilets provide a refreshing aesthetic, especially in contemporary settings. Plus, they simplify cleaning—a win-win!"
Two-piece Toilets


Two-piece toilets consist of a separate tank and bowl, making this type widely available and often more budget-friendly. This configuration offers greater flexibility; for instance, if you're looking to replace only the bowl or tank, you can do that without needing to buy an entirely new unit.
With a variety of styles and sizes, two-piece toilets allow for a broader selection, making it possible to find one that fits well within your design scheme. However, the seams between tank and bowl can collect grime, which may require more frequent cleaning. Still, their versatility in terms of parts and repair makes them a popular choice for many homeowners.
Wall-mounted Toilets
Wall-mounted toilets present an innovative option, as they free up floor space by attaching directly to the wall. This feature not only makes cleaning easier but also creates a more spacious appearance in the bathroom, which is particularly beneficial in tight quarters.
These toilets generally include a concealed tank, enhancing the aesthetic appeal. While they may come at a higher upfront cost, the savings on water and space utilization in the long run make them a worthwhile investment. Accessibility is another important factor; these toilets can often be mounted at various heights, catering to users' needs, which is especially advantageous for households with children or elderly residents.

Flush Efficiency
Gravity-fed vs. Pressure-assisted
Flush efficiency is about how well a toilet gets rid of waste without wasting too much water. There are two main technologies: gravity-fed and pressure-assisted toilets.
- Gravity-fed toilets have been around for ages. They rely on the force of gravity to push the water down from the tank to the bowl. This makes them generally quieter, and they don't require a lot of maintenance. They are popular because they do the job without extra fuss. However, if not enough water is used, there may be a chance of incomplete flushing, which can be a hassle.
- On the other hand, pressure-assisted toilets are a bit of a different animal. They are designed to use pressurized air to push water into the bowl. This means flushing is almost the same as using a fire hose - powerful and efficient. In some ways, they provide a more thorough clean. Yet, the trade-off is that they can run louder, which might be off-putting for those who prefer peace. So, choice comes down to your personal preference regarding noise and maintenance.
Low-flow Options
Now, let’s talk about low-flow options. These toilets use less water compared to traditional models, making them an excellent choice for sustainability-conscious homeowners. When we’re reeling from the effects of rising utility bills, these toilets reduce water usage while still providing effective flushing.
- A significant feature of low-flow toilets is the 1.6 gallons per flush (GPF) standard, down from the 3.5 GPF of older models. This large decrease leads to a substantial savings on water bills over time.
- However, switching to low-flow can sometimes come with concerns about performance. If you choose this option, ensure that you're selecting a well-rated model. Think twice about situations where it may struggle to flush larger waste – that would be a truly uncomfortable situation in your daily life.
Comfort Height
Comfort height toilets are another worth considering. The height of a toilet can seem trivial until you start using one. Standard toilets typically stand at 15 inches from floor to seat, but comfort height ones rise to around 17-19 inches. For many, especially taller individuals or those with mobility issues, this extra few inches means the difference between comfort and strain.
The American Disabilities Act suggests this height as more accessible. So, installing a comfort height toilet might not only suit your aesthetic preferences but improve general ease and accessibility in your bathroom, ensuring everyone in your home feels at ease.

Quality Concerns
One of the first red flags that emerge while evaluating discount bathroom toilets revolves around quality. It's a universal truth that sometimes, when you pay less, you might get less. The construction of these toilets may not meet the same standards as higher-end models. For instance, many budget-friendly designs often utilize inferior materials like plastic instead of durable ceramics, which can significantly affect longevity. Over time, this can lead to issues such as cracks or leaks, which are not only inconvenient but can also lead to expensive repairs.
Moreover, the flushing mechanisms in discounted toilets can vary widely. Those cheaper options may not be as efficient, leading to more frequent clogs or poor flushing performance. Depending on your plumbing situation, that could mean calling a plumber sooner rather than later, negating some of the initial savings you thought you scored. It’s worth weighing how much you value durability versus cost.

Limited Warranty Options
Another concern that often pops up with discount bathroom toilets is limited warranty coverage. Premium brands usually offer extensive warranties that cover everything from manufacturing defects to performance issues. On the other hand, many discount models may come with very limited warranties, leaving buyers high and dry when unexpected problems arise.
Should a factory flaw appear, the last thing you want is to be left holding the bag without a safety net. Limited warranties can make purchasing these toilets resemble a gamble. One needs to consider: is the risk worth the potential savings?
In evaluating warranties, pay attention to the fine print. Often manufacturers will provide just a year or two of coverage, while others might restrict warranty claims to specific parts or only if the product is installed by licensed professionals. Therefore, before sealing the deal, being well-informed on warranty policies can safeguard you from potential headaches down the road.

Step-by-Step Installation Guide
Here’s how to roll up your sleeves and get that toilet in place:
- Install the Wax Ring:
Place the wax ring on the toilet flange. Make sure it's centered and sits evenly. - Position the Toilet:
Lift the toilet carefully and align it with the bolts protruding from the flange. Set it down gently onto the wax ring, pressing down to create a seal. - Secure the Bolts:
Fasten the nuts onto the bolts, securing the toilet without forcing it too tight. - Connect the Water Supply:
Attach the water line to the toilet tank, tightening it with an adjustable wrench. Be mindful of cross-threading any connections here. - Turn On the Water:
Open the shut-off valve slowly and allow the tank to fill. Check for leaks around the fittings and the base. - Test Flush:
Give the toilet a whirl—flush it a couple of times to ensure that the water is flowing properly.
Common Installation Errors
Even the best plans can go awry. Here are some frequent mistakes to avoid:
- Miscalculating the Flange Height: If the flange is too low or too high, the toilet will not install correctly, leading to leaks.
- Not Using a Wax Ring: A common pitfall is skipping the wax ring altogether. This small piece plays a huge role in sealing and preventing leaks.
- Over-tightening Bolts: It might seem intuitive to crank down hard, but over-tightening can crack the toilet base.
- Ignoring Water Supply Valve: Forget to open the water supply valve? You’ll be wondering why the tank isn't filling!

Troubleshooting Common Issues


No matter how careful you are, issues can crop up in discount toilets just like any other. Knowing how to troubleshoot these common problems can save a world of hassle.
Some frequent concerns include running toilets, noisy flushes, or leaks. A running toilet can often be attributed to a faulty flapper or chain that’s too tight. A quick adjustment usually resolves it. For noisy flushes, checking the water level in the tank can prove helpful; it might just need some tweaking. Lastly, leaks can stem from several places including the tank or the base. Identifying the source is the first step; often, tightening a few bolts can work wonders.

Water-efficient Models
Water conservation is a hot topic, and rightly so. Standard toilets can use up to 6 gallons per flush, which adds up quickly over time. Enter water-efficient models! These toilets aim to reduce water consumption without sacrificing performance. Models certified by the Environmental Protection Agency’s WaterSense program are designed specifically for this purpose.
Benefits of these water-efficient options include:
- Reduced water bills: Saving water means saving money. Lower your monthly expenses just by flushing smarter.
- Eco-friendly impact: These toilets typically use 1.28 gallons or less per flush, significantly less than traditional toilets.
- High performance: Many of these models are crafted using advanced technology that ensures they flush effectively every time. It's like hitting two birds with one stone; you save water and maintain a clean, functional bathroom space.
